Types of Carpet Padding

1. Rebond Padding (Bonded Foam)

Best suited for:

Cut pile carpets (plush, Saxony, textured)

General living areas and bedrooms

Homes seeking an economical, all-round solution

2. Memory Foam Padding (Types Of Carpet Padding)

Best suited for:

Bedrooms and low-traffic areas

Plush and luxurious carpets

Spaces where comfort is prioritised over firmness

3. Rubber Padding (Flat or Frothed)

Best suited for:

Berber and loop pile carpets

Situations requiring long-term performance

High-traffic areas (hallways, stairs)

4. Fibre Padding (Natural or Synthetic)

Best suited for:

Frequently used areas (hallways, stairs)

Berber and loop pile carpets

Situations requiring long-term performance

5. Urethane Foam Padding (Prime Foam)

Best suited for:

Light-traffic rooms

Budget-conscious installations

Carpets where moderate comfort is acceptable

Why Matching Padding to Carpet Type Matters

Carpet and padding function as a unified system. A mismatch, for instance, using excessively soft padding beneath dense loop carpets, can contribute to wrinkling, uneven wear, and a shortened lifespan. Indeed, choosing padding with suitable density and support helps maintain comfort, appearance, and long-term durability. For this reason, understanding the types of carpet padding is highly beneficial.

Aside from the comfort it provides, carpet padding offers essential protection for your carpets. For example, it acts as a barrier against moisture, preventing spills from seeping through to the subfloor, which can lead to mould and mildew. Additionally, it helps keep carpets in place, reducing movement and wrinkles that could cause tripping hazards. Moreover, carpet padding enhances carpet cleaning benefits by making vacuuming more effective and reducing wear from foot traffic. Finally, the extra insulation and cushioning help make your home more energy-efficient.
